Actually it depends on a few factors.
1. Do you meet the advance purchase requirements of the new flights for original fare?
2. Does your new flight change meet min/max stay requirements?
3. Does your new flight meet day/time provisions?
4. Does your new flight meet seasonality?
5. Does new flight/possible fare meet combinability of original fare?
These are some of the things that we look at when tickets are being reissued. Any of the above conditions that are not met could result in the complete "start from scratch approach"...otherwise normal recalculation of return fare component only.
